Co-directing are Khaya Ndlovu Mpehle and Kensiwe Tshabalala, two women whose journeys through South African theatre have often followed unexpected paths.
The production is a full circle moment for Ndlovu Mpehle, who graduated from the NSA in 2009 as a dance major.
From there the two began shaping their own distinctly South African version of A Chorus Line.
“The musical theatre industry in South Africa is not really reflecting the South African experience,” Tshabalala says.
Ndlovu Mpehle adds that the show also pulls back a curtain rarely lifted for audiences: the hierarchy that sits above even the director.
